How much does it cost to rent an apartment in May Penn?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| May Penn Studio Apartments | $1,034 | $625 | $1,738 |
| May Penn 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,158 | $650 | $10,000+ |
| May Penn 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,393 | $749 | $7,100 |
| May Penn 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,284 | $1,299 | $4,995 |
How much does it cost to rent a home in May Penn?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2 Bedroom Homes | $2,888 | $945 | $10,000+ |
| 3 Bedroom Homes | $1,661 | $1,050 | $3,500 |
| 4 Bedroom Homes | $2,220 | $1,695 | $3,000 |
| 5 Bedroom Homes | $3,575 | $2,950 | $4,200 |
